Courses Offered
AI-900: Microsoft Azure AI Fundamentals
This beginner-friendly course introduces the fundamentals of AI and how Microsoft Azure enables intelligent solutions. No prior technical background is required.
Virtual | Multiple sessions | Hands-on | April
- Requisites – Participants must be based in Nigeria, have access to a personal laptop or computer, and a reliable internet connection & must be familiar with web browsers such as Chrome, Edge, and others.
- Ideal for – Early learners and non-technical roles.
- What you’ll learn – You’ll learn about core AI workloads and use cases, the fundamentals of machine learning on Azure, and how to work with vision and natural language processing (NLP) workloads. The course also covers key principles of responsible AI.
- Hands-on with m– Azure AI Vision, Azure Machine Learning, Azure AI Language, Azure Bot Services & Azure OpenAI.
- Level – Beginner friendly
- Format – Instructor online-led sessions + Lab-based learning.
Agentic AI Hackathon For Developers
Take your AI skills to the next level with advanced generative AI training. This hands-on course is designed to equip developers and technical professionals with the skills to build intelligent applications using Azure OpenAI and the Semantic Kernel SDK. Participants would also complete in a hackathon where real world problems would be addressed with the application AI.
- Requisites – Participants should come with their personal computers, be familiar with Visual Studio Code IDE, .NET Framework, Azure OpenAI (or OpenAI API), and any or all of these programming languages: C#, Python, Java, JavaScript. Additionally, they must be available to attend the in-person training sessions in Lagos, Nigeria.
- Ideal for –Developers, Software Engineers, Data Scientists and Machine Learning Specialists.
- What you’ll learn – You will learn how to build custom AI agents using Semantic Kernel SDK, develop plugins and inteligent planners, and apply prompt engineering and optimization techniques.
- Level – Intermediate to advanced
In-person | Lagos, Nigeria | April 23 – April 24
